Main Plant Tissues• Dermal Tissue - covers the outside of
the plant & protects it• Ground Tissue - inside the dermal
tissue; provides support, stores materials & is the site of photosynthesis
• Vascular Tissue - transports water & nutrients throughout the plant– Xylem transports water– Phloem transports food

Roots• Roots anchor plants & absorb mineral
nutrients from the soil

Stems• Stems support plants, transport
materials & provide storage

• Primary Growth• Occurs in apical meristem• Lengthens roots & stems

Secondary Growth• Occurs in lateral meristems• Adds to the width of roots and stems

Leaves• Leaves collect sunlight for
photosynthesis• The top of a leaf contains most of the
chloroplasts & is where most photosynthesis takes place

Leaves–Gases are exchanged through openings
called stomata, which are opened & closed by surrounding cells called guard cells

FlowersFlowers contain sepals and petals, which are
often brightly colored to attract animal pollinators

• A stamen is the male structure of the flower.
– anther produces pollen grains – filament supports the anther

• The innermost layer of a flower is the female pistil.
– stigma is sticky tip – style is tube leading from stigma to ovary – ovary produces egg cells
